Basement Window Installation : Safety and Value for Your Basement
Thinking about upgrading/enhancing/improving your basement? An egress window can add a major touch of value to your house/boost the worth of your home/increase the selling price of your property. Besides being an excellent investment, these windows are also crucial for your safety and well-being in case of an emergency. An egress window provides a safe and legal escape route from your basement, meeting code requirements.
- Prior to installation, consider the configuration of the window.
- A licensed professional can help you choose the right size and location for your basement.
Considering an egress window is a great idea. Not only does it improve your home's value, but it also offers protection in emergencies.
Turn That Dark Basement Into a Light-Filled Oasis
Don't get more info let your basement languish in perpetual gloom! Through a few strategic strategies, you can revamp this often-neglected space into a bright and inviting haven. Start by utilizing natural light. Think about adding skylights or ample windows to inject sunshine into the space.
- Complement this with strategically placed artificial lighting, such as adjustable fixtures and task lights.
- Incorporate light-colored paint on the walls and ceiling to diffuse existing light.
- Style with reflective surfaces to more brighten the space.
With a little effort, your basement can become a favorite retreat in your home.
